If you'd like to create a button that may be employed for a URL anywhere, produce a button class for an anchor.
Crucial: Any assignment turned in or marked performed after the thanks date is recorded as late, Even when you previously submitted the perform before the due date.
It truly is actualy quite simple and without having using any variety components. You'll be able to just make use of the tag with a button inside of :).
The one strategy to do this (apart from BalusC's ingenious kind notion!) is by introducing a JavaScript onclick occasion into the button, which is not fantastic for accessibility. Have you regarded as styling a traditional link like a button? You can't reach OS particular buttons that way, nonetheless it's still the simplest way IMO.
Couple of many years later, while my Answer nevertheless performs, Bear in mind You should use lots of CSS to make it appear whichever you want. This was just a quick way.
Mentioned must be that, historically, the CSS appearance:button property worked in addition in some browsers, but this was experimental and wound up remaining thought of a misfeature. Only none or automobile are permitted on things.
Need to make improvements to an assignment that you now turned in? Just unsubmit the work, make the adjustments, and switch it in yet again.
I would go together with: Adhere this one to the url, as you want them to determine the actual focus on which the connection details to, rather then the link itself.
tamayuratamayura 40322 silver badges66 bronze badges Incorporate a comment
two Even though People are valid factors, I do not genuinely Assume that basically tackle accessibility. Did you suggest usability, not accessibility? In Website growth accessibility is normally reserved to be precisely about no matter whether people who definitely have visual impairments can run your software well.
Illustration can be keyboard navigation - links are brought on With all the enter crucial, buttons are activated by House bar. If a backlink appears like a button, a keyboard navigator would expect to make use of the Place bar to induce it and uncover it that doesn't operate because it's secretly a website link.
When linking A further local file, just set it in a similar folder and increase the file name because the reference. Or specify the location of your file if in is not really in exactly the same folder.
I realized there have been a lot of solutions submitted, but none of them appeared to really nail the situation. Here is my consider at an answer:
The JavaScript code takes advantage of celebration delegation to help you connect an celebration listener before the as well as exist. I'm working with jQuery in this example, because it is speedy and easy, nevertheless it can be carried out in 'vanilla' JavaScript at the same time.
Heading coupled with what a few Some others have extra, you are able to go wild with just using an easy CSS class without having PHP, no jQuery code, just simple HTML and CSS.